Malvern Couple Weds in May 15 Presbyterian Ceremony

Lois Clay and Marlin Henderson exchanged vows May 15 at the Presbyterian church in Malvern in a double ring ceremony conducted by Rev. Hugh Shiveley. The couple, both from nearby families, were attended by sisters and relatives as bridesmaids and groomsmen. A reception followed at the Community building hosted by the Presbyterian Guild. The bride wore a silk organza gown with pearl lace and a chapel train. her attendants wore lavender taffeta. The couple resides on a farm east of Malvern after graduation from local schools.

Program Honored Mothers at CES Meeting Tuesday

Silver Urn Chapter honored mothers Tuesday evening at the Masonic Temple in Malvern before their regular meeting. Mrs. Elmer Jackson welcomed guests, with Miss Chelly Mort delivering a Rainbow solo and DeMolay boys presenting the ceremony and Flower Talk. Guests from Malvern and nearby towns attended. the evening closed with a social hour. A June 30 special meeting was planned after the usual business session. Mills Republican Women to Elect Officers May 26

Members of the Mills County Republican Women's club meet at 9 30 a m on May 26 for a coffee in the bank courtesy room at Glenwood. There will be an election of officers. Guest will be Mrs Manning Walker of Avora seventh district president.

Day Camp Registration Opens for Neighborhood 13

Neighborhood 13 day camp runs June 14 to 18 for Girl Scouts aged 7 to 17. Fees are 3 dollars for Brownies 3.50 for Juniors and Cadettes. Register by Friday May 21 with Mrs. Mary Roamajel at the Malvern Bank.
